NOTE 1 -  SUMMARY OF SIGNIFICANT ACCOUNTING POLICIES

                a.     Organization

                The financial statements presented are those of Advanced
                Biological Systems, Inc. (A Development Stage Company) (the
                Company). The Company was incorporated in the State of Delaware
                on October 3, 1988. The Company was organized to develop and
                operate centers for the treatment of diseases of the immune
                system. The Company discontinued operations in 1992 and is now
                seeking new business opportunities.

                b.     Accounting Method

                The Company's financial statements are prepared using the
                accrual method of accounting. The Company has elected a calendar
                year end.

                c.     Loss Per Share

                The computation of loss per share of common stock is based on
                the weighted average number of shares outstanding during the
                period.

                d.     Deferred Offering Costs

                In connection with the public offering of the Company's common
                stock (see Note 2), all costs were accumulated as deferred
                charges. The deferred charges were offset against capital in
                excess of par value upon successful completion of the offering.

                e.     Cash Equivalents

                The Company considers all highly liquid investments with a
                maturity of three months or less when purchased to be cash
                equivalents.

                f.      Income Taxes

                No provision for income taxes has been accrued because the
                Company has net operating losses from inception. The net
                operating loss carryforwards totalling $8,299,788 at December
                31, 1994, expire in 2009. No tax benefit has been reported in
                the financial statements because the Company is uncertain if the
                carryforwards will expire unused. Accordingly, the potential tax
                benefits are offset by a valuation account of the same amount.

NOTE 1 -SUMMARY OF SIGNIFICANT ACCOUNTING POLICIES (Continued)

                g.     Stock Split

                On November 15, 1989, the Company effected a forward split of
                its common shares outstanding on a 4-for-1 basis in the form of
                a stock dividend. On June 29, 1992, the Company effected a
                reverse stock split of its common shares outstanding on a
                1-for-3 basis. The financial statements have been restated
                retroactively to reflect the effects to these stock splits.

NOTE 2 - STOCK ISSUANCES

                During the three months ended June 30, 1995, there were no stock
                issuances.

NOTE 3 - DISCONTINUED OPERATIONS

                In 1992, the Company discontinued all operations due to a lack
                of working capital. The Company is currently inactive and is
                seeking other business opportunities.

NOTE 4 - GOING CONCERN

                The Company's financial statements are prepared using generally
                accepted accounting principles applicable to a going concern.
                However, the Company has experienced operating losses and no
                longer has a source of revenues. The Company is seeking new
                business opportunities through merger or purchase of existing,
                operating companies. Until that time, the Company's operating
                expenses may be financed by advances from a major shareholder.
                Due to the limited assets of the Company, no assurance can be
                given that the Company will continue as a going concern.

NOTE 5 -        COMMITMENTS AND CONTINGENCIES

                For the year ended, December 31, 1992, the Company wrote off
                certain accounts payable which were either disputed or never
                paid. The statute of limitations has run for most of the
                undisputed payables, but has not run for the disputed payables.
                As of the date of issuance of these financial statements, no
                attempt has been made to collect these amounts from the Company.
                The disputed amounts totalled $179,999 at December 31,1992. The
                Company's management believes that the risk that the Company
                will be required to pay any of the disputed amounts is remote.

           MANAGEMENT'S DISCUSSION AND ANALYSIS OF FINANCIAL CONDITION
                AND RESULTS OF OPERATIONS AND PLAN OF OPERATIONS

         The Company is subject to the reporting requirements under the
Securities Exchange Act of 1934. Notwithstanding such requirements, the last
report filed by the Company (exclusive of a Form 8-K with date of report of
December 18, 1994, filed December 28, 1994) was a Form 10-Q for its quarter year
ended September 30, 1992. The Company, during the first six months of 1996
embarked upon an effort to bring itself "current" with respect to its reporting
requirements and in that regard has prepared and filed (or is in the process of
filing) the following reports as indicated:

Form 10-KSB for calendar year ended December 31, 1992 

Forms 10-QSB for quarters ended March 31, 1993, June 30, 1993 and 
September 30, 1993 

Form 10-KSB for calendar year ended December 31, 1993 

Forms 10-QSB for quarters ended March 31, 1994, June 30, 1994 and 
September 30, 1994 

Form 10-KSB for calendar year ended December 31, 1994 

Forms 10-QSB for quarters ended March 31, 1995, June 30, 1995 and 
September 30, 1995 

Form 10-KSB for calendar year ended December 31, 1995 and

Form 10-QSB for quarter ended March 31, 1996

         Each of the above referenced reports were basically prepared at or
around the same time and forwarded for filing purposes on or about the same
date.

         Each of the above referenced reports clearly indicate that the Company
has not had any revenues from operations since its inception in 1988. Such
reports further indicate that in 1992 the Company discontinued all operations
due to lack of working capital and that the Company has been inactive and
remained inactive through March 31, 1996.

         Such reports further indicate that from time to time, and as management
felt the need arose, the Company utilized sale of its securities for purposes of
obtaining operating capital and/or in order to settle certain outstanding
indebtedness. For a complete summarization of all shares of Company common stock
issued from inception through December 31, 1995, reference is herewith made to
the audited statement of stockholders' equity as same appears in the Company's
Form 10-KSB for calendar year ended December 31, 1995.

         Such statement of stockholders' equity (taken in conjunction with those
prior audited statements of stockholders' equity for calendar years ended
December 31, 1992, 1993 and 1994) indicates, in part, as follows:

Calendar year ended December 31,

A)       1992 - the Company issued 1,437,095 shares of its common stock
         in settlement of debt in the amount of $1,192,445.  During
         such time period the Company also issued 347,693 shares of its
         common stock in private placements for net proceeds of
         $513,735.

B)       1993 - the Company issued 220,875 shares of its common stock
         in settlement of debt in the amount of $220,875.  During such
         time period the Company also issued 666,666 shares of its
         common stock in private placements for net proceeds of
         $103,250.

C)       1994 - no new shares of common stock were issued.

D)       1995 - the Company issued 14,000,000 shares of its common
         stock in settlement of debt in the amount of $140,398.  During
         such time period the Company also issued 3,400,000 shares of
         its common stock in private placements for net proceeds of
         $100,000.

No shares of common stock were issued during the first quarter of 1996.

         As can be seen from the above, from January 1, 1992 through March 31,
1996 an aggregate of 15,657,970 shares of Company common stock were issued for
purposes of retiring debt in the amount of $1,553,718. Accordingly, as a direct
result of the above (and taking into consideration debt retirement in exchange
for securities) Company liabilities (which consists of accounts payable - trade)
were reduced to $55,327 as of March 31, 1996.

         Subsequent to March 31, 1996 and during the first two weeks of April,
1996, the Company issued an additional 1,000,000 shares of its common stock for
cash consideration in the amount of $35,000. The Company further authorized
issuance of an additional 70,000 shares of its common stock in settlement, on
May 8, 1996, of a claim by a former officer for use of his name on stock
certificates subsequent to his resignation. Accordingly, as of July 8, 1996 the
total number of shares of common stock issued and outstanding amounted to
27,781,234.

         Once each of the above referenced Forms 10-QSB and 10-KSB have been
filed the Company will be current with respect to its reporting requirements and
will be in a position so as to pursue its current business objectives, i.e., to
seek potential business opportunities which in the opinion of management may
provide a profit to the Company. Such involvement may be either in the form of
an acquisition of existing business(s) and/or the acquisition of assets in order
to establish subsidiary business(es) for the Company. These plans remain in
their formative stages and are, accordingly, subject to change if and when
alternative business

                                        4


<PAGE>   18



opportunities arise. At the present time management considers the Company's
principal asset to be the fact that the Company is a "public" company trading on
the electronic over-the-counter bulletin board, thereby creating a "value" for
the Company which might not otherwise exist if it were not a public company. An
example of such "value" relates directly to the Company's ability to, as
aforesaid, retire a substantial amount of outstanding indebtedness in exchange
for issuance of its securities, thereby creating a relatively broad base of
interested stockholders, many of whom were former creditors of the Company.
